A friend fowarded this to me and its too neat not to share.
Thes are actual photos of damage to a house caused by a exploding 183 liter, V16 diesel locomotive engine! This one piston would make Sonny Leonard smile, each cylinder displaces 697 cubic inches! And we thought TF anf FC explosions were violent! |

BTW very interesting post. Back in the early 90's a guy who worked for my dad had a 2 cyl. tractor he competed with in a stock class at a tractor pull. We took the motor apart and replaced the stock cast iron pistons with a venolia piston. The piston was 3 pounds lighter but by the time we balanced it whole assembly and took over 20 lbs off the flywheel he won ever event he went to. If I remember right the venolia piston was over 1000 grams, but the stock piston 3600 grams. Herb Jr |
